Microcirculatory Oxygen Uptake in Sepsis
NCT02430142 · Status: COMPLETED · Type: OBSERVATIONAL · Enrollment: 102
Last updated 2018-05-02
Summary
Forearm vasoocclusive testing (VOT) will be performed with laser-doppler spectrophotometry system in septic patients on ICU. Microcirculatory oxygen uptake will be checked for prognostic value and for associations with tissue hypoxia markers and high central venus saturations.

Vasoocclusive testing
Forearm vasoocclusive testing with a laser-doppler spectrophotometry system, transpulmonary thermodilution and blood sampling;
